Easy Peach Cobbler/Crisp

ingredients
- 1 (29 ounce) can peaches, drained
- 1 (14 ounce) can peaches, drained
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 3⁄4 cup white sugar
- 3⁄4 cup brown sugar
- 1 pinch salt
- 1⁄4 teaspoon nutmeg
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ons cinnamon
- 1 cup cold butter (cubed and cut into small pieces, no substitutes!)
- vanilla ice cream (optional)
directions
- Set oven to 350 degrees.
- Butter a 13 x 9-inch baking dish.
- Spread both cans drained peaches into the baking pan.
- Mix together flour, white and brown sugar, salt, nutmeg and cinnamon in a large bowl until well combined; add in cold butter pieces and mix until the consistancy of peas (I use my hands for this).
- Sprinkle the crumbs over the peaches in the baking dish.
- Bake for about 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.
- Cool slightly then serve warm with ice cream.
